The discharge of compound P and calcitonin gene-linked peptide is also associated with migraines. It can be hypothesized [176] that an enormous launch of serotonin with the median raphe is correlated with the activation of serotonergic receptors Positioned within the partitions of huge cerebral vessels. This will likely cause an increase in the transmural force of such vessels and improves vasodilatation. The increase in transmural force brings about the activation in the trigeminal nerve with consequent antidromic stimulation of the sensory nerves that is definitely translated into your consequent release of pro-inflammatory peptides (material P and calcitonin gene-associated peptide) at the extent of hard vessels within the meninges [177,178].

PG is produced with the AA through the catalysis of COX. They are available in other tissue within our bodies and therefore are regarded as an archetypal sensitizing agent that decreases the nociceptive threshold in addition to the Main reason behind tenderness. PGE2 (made by cyclooxygenase-2) and prostacyclin (PGI2) (made by cyclooxygenase-1) are two main prostaglandins that cause a direct afferent sensitization. The receptor of PGE2 is usually divided into four main varieties, which include prostaglandin E2 receptor style 1–four (EP1–4), Whilst the receptor of PGI2 is termed prostacyclin receptor (IP).

For such a pain, the area of research concentrates totally on the afferent component as it has been revealed the administration of some prescription drugs, like local anesthetics, can alleviate ongoing neuropathic pain [157]. The continuing afferent activity might act in alternative ways in order to induce alterations in transduction. The mechanisms could vary and could include the expression of transducers in neurons that normally usually do not Specific such a transducer, the increase in expression of excitatory receptors [158], and/or maybe the lessen of inhibitory transducers [159]. A different system could be the expression of thermal or mechanical transducers near the extremity from the Reduce, damaged axon [159], or Within the ganglia [one hundred sixty]. It can be plausible to hypothesize that the assorted processes manifest and collaborate simultaneously to add to the continuing exercise in the afferents influenced for the duration of nerve injuries. The origins from the action may consist of, as Beforehand talked about, the ectopic expression of transducers [161]. 1 illustration is the anomalous activation of nociceptors by norepinephrine which ends up in the sympathetic write-up-ganglionic terminals that happen to be expressed on ganglia [162] along with the alteration in expression and density of ion channels that causes instability and spontaneous action on the membrane [163]. These mechanisms of activity are not merely a consequence of the harm but are prone to be a results of the varied changes that occur as time passes. For these motives, neuropathic pain is hard to control.
